How much larger is a magnitude 9 earthquake than a magnitude 5.

Respuesta :

MJDelosReyes
MJDelosReyes MJDelosReyes
  • 01-12-2021

Answer:

That is, the wave amplitude in a level 6 earthquake is 10 times greater than in a level 5 earthquake, and the amplitude increases 100 times between a level 7 earthquake and a level 9 earthquake. The amount of energy released increases 31.7 times between whole number values.
